A Great Hunt (Japanese: 狩猟に導かれし道 Showing the Way to Hunt) is the eighth paralogue chapter in Fire Emblem Fates. As a paralogue chapter, its events are not integral to the game's main storyline and can be done at the player's leisure. The chapter is unlocked after both clearing chapter 10 in either Birthright or Revelation, and have Takumi married.
In this chapter, Takumi's son, Kiragi, gets into trouble with mysterious invaders when returning from a hunting trip in his Deeprealm. It is up to Corrin and his/her army to help bail Kiragi out of this situation.
Plot
- Main article:
A Great Hunt/Script
Takumi asks where his son could be and curses the Deeprealm they're in for being large in size; he then states he can't expect Kiragi to stay in his village nonstop, but he states he at least thought he'd be out hunting or fishing. Sakura calls out to Takumi to come to her quickly, stating that a band of invaders has followed them into the Deeprealm; Takumi asks which invaders followed them in, then deduces that Kiragi might be in the area. Sakura asks Takumi what they should do as the invaders are headed toward them; Takumi states that they go after the invaders head-on.
Meanwhile, in another area of the Deeprealm, Kiragi summarizes the day he had, especially his fish yield and bagging a bear, lamenting he had wished he had done the latter closer to town as it's too big to lug back from his current location or roll back into town; as Kiragi contemplates how to get the bear back to town, he notices one of the invaders and decides to make it his next catch, shooting the invader with his yumi. As Kiragi notices he hit the invader with his shot, he then notices the invader is still alive, and afterward more invaders surrounding him; Kiragi then states that he'll make all of the invaders target practice. Sakura and Takumi arrive on the scene, to which Sakura is the first to notice Takumi taking on the invaders alone; Takumi calls out to Kiragi that he's on his way. Preparations take place at this point; the battle begins once preparations are complete.
Should Takumi and Kiragi speak during the battle, Takumi assumes Kiragi was scared, to which Kiragi denies; the two of them start to talk about the bear Kiragi bagged, to which Takumi states that they should focus on getting out of this situation alive.
Once the battle ends, Kiragi starts to talk about Takumi's battle prowess, after which Takumi starts to talk about his previous battle before changing the topic and states that this battle was quite dangerous; Kiragi attempts to talk Takumi into being allowed to leave the Deeprealm, to which Takumi states the reason Kiragi's in the Deeprealm is to keep him away from the war. After Sakura chimes in on Kiragi's battle prowess, Kiragi finally talks Takumi into joining up with Corrin's army, then brings up the bear again; Takumi then states that the bear would make for an excellent stew back at camp.

Level scaling data
This chapter's enemy and new player units are subject to level scaling mechanisms that increase their levels as the player makes progress along the main story path. The tables below show the differences between the initial levels of the units and the levels of the units at each particular main story path chapter position. Initial unpromoted units who reach an effective level of 21 will become promoted units of level (effective level -20) unless otherwise stated.
Chapter | 11 | 12 | 13 | 14 | 15 | 16 | 17 | 18 | 19 | 20 | 21 | 22 | 23 | 24 | 25 | 26 | 27 |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Levels from previous chapter | 0 | +1 | +1 | +2 | +1 | +2 | +1 | +2 | +2 | +2 | +2 | +2 | +2 | +2 | +2 | +2 | +2 |
Total levels gained | 0 | +1 | +2 | +4 | +5 | +7 | +8 | +10 | +12 | +14 | +16 | +18 | +20 | +22 | +24 | +26 | +28 |
- Additional notes: Kiragi stops visibly scaling upon hitting level 20 unpromoted at the chapter 18 position; from the chapter 19 position onward, Kiragi will have an Offspring Seal in his inventory. Initial unpromoted enemy units become promoted at the chapter 19 position. The boss reaches level 20 at the chapter 22 position and stops scaling from this point; all other initial promoted enemy units reach level 20 at the chapter 23 position and stop scaling from this point.

Strategy
This section details unofficial strategies that may help with completion of the chapter. This may not work for everybody. |
This section has been marked as a stub. Please help improve the page by adding information.
If it looks like Kiragi wouldn't survive the enemies that are near his starting position, bring a Rescue staff and position your troops to deal with the initial wave of fliers.. Afterwards, most of the enemies will only advance once you move inside their attack radius; but they will become aggressive after a certain amount of time have passed.
